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our IICRC-certified technicians will arrive quickly to assess the situation, taking note of the affected areas, water levels, and any potential hazards. This initial inspection helps us develop a customized plan tailored to your specific needs.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ll deploy our state-of-the-art water extraction equipment to rapidly remove standing water from your property. This crucial step prevents further damage and reduces the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our advanced drying and dehumidification systems will be deployed to thoroughly dry out your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This meticulous process ensures that your property is completely free from excess moisture.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

With the drying process complete, our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including carpets, upholstery, and hard surfaces.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, or ceilings.

Fire Sprinkler Discharge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 100 square feet) Yes No You can contain and clean up the spill yourself,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Water damage from a fire sprinkler system (more than 100 square feet) No Yes A fire sprinkler system water discharge need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ough cleanup.
Hidden water damage behind wal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den water damage can compromise the structural integrity of your property and lead to serious health issues if left unchecked. A professional assessment and cleanup are necessary to ensure your property remains safe and secure.

Fire Sprinkler Discharge Water Removal Cost in Battle Ground, WA

The cost of Fire Sprinkler Discharge Water Removal in Battle Ground, WA can vary greatly depending on the severity of the situation,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of your property and a customized plan tailored to your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the situation.
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The amount of standing water and the equipment required for the job.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
